Morphology

hoopster = hoop (transparent) = hoop + ster

Derived from 'hoop' (here understood as the basketball hoop) plus the agentive/slang suffix '-ster', yielding 'a person associated with hoops (basketball)'; the sense is a straightforward slang extension.

Etymology

The word hoopster comes from hoop and the ending -ster, which makes a word for a person, like in youngster. People also call basketball 'hoops', so a hoopster is a slang word for a basketball player.
